<p class="has-x-large-font-size"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">SD A Power Rankings</span></str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ph {"fontSize":"medium"} -->
<p class="has-medium-font-size"><strong>#1 Sioux Falls Christian (3-0)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>It is hard to argue with the Chargers being #1. They took care of business vs. O'Grman with a 19-point win and held the Knights to a slim 39 points. [player_tooltip player_id='1503883' first='Griffen' last='Goodbary'] is the BIG man with great length and exceeding potential. [player_tooltip player_id='1390318' first='Cole' last='Snyder'] is the lead guard. [player_tooltip player_id='1390319' first='Britton' last='Mulder'] is not healthy yet and he might be the most exciting player in the program. Keep eyes on [player_tooltip player_id='1467167' first='Carson' last='Nickles'] and [player_tooltip player_id='1545638' first='Cooper' last='Goodbary'] as young playmakers.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ph {"fontSize":"medium"} -->
<p class="has-medium-font-size"><strong>#2 Hamlin (2-0)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Coach Neuendorf has his squad firing on all cylinders early in the season. Hamlin is healthy and they are looking great. Tonight they host Milbank. [player_tooltip player_id='1625191' first='Easton' last='Neuendorf'] is the best passing PG in South Dakota and [player_tooltip player_id='1331228' first='Tyson' last='Stevenson'] is a playmaker on the wing. The Chargers have plenty of other scoring weapons and their size/athleticism will make you weep.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ph {"fontSize":"medium"} -->
<p class="has-medium-font-size"><strong>#3 Sioux Valley (3-0)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Coach Vincent has the Cossacks running hot but that is no surprise! Sioux Valley has a tradition of winning and that will continue this season. [player_tooltip player_id='1266223' first='Alec' last='Squires'], [player_tooltip player_id='2233704' first='Maxwell' last='Engebretson'], and [player_tooltip player_id='1263164' first='Maverick' last='Nelson'] make about as scary a trio as you can imagine. The Cossacks have a great group of role players as well. In any close game, you have to give the nod to the Cossacks!</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ph {"fontSize":"medium"} -->
<p class="has-medium-font-size"><strong>#4 Dakota Valley (4-0)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>It is hard to bet against the Panthers! DV just wins and wins! Coach Kleis has his team on a 57-game win streak and they show no signs of slowing down. [player_tooltip player_id='1270366' first='Jaxson' last='Wingert'] is dominating and putting up splashy numbers. [player_tooltip player_id='1625208' first='Luke' last='Bruns'] looked great this offseason and he has proven to be phenomenal early in the year for DV. Tomorrow night, the Panthers play at Lakota Tech, which will be a good test, and it will be a nice way to head into the Christmas Break with another win.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ph {"fontSize":"medium"} -->
<p class="has-medium-font-size"><strong>#5 Pine Ridge (4-0)</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>The Thorpes are rolling and they look excellent. Pine Ridge is fresh off a Championship at the Lakota Nation Invitational in Rapid City. Taking home that crown is a great feather to put in the cap and an excellent accomplishment. The Thorpes beat Rapid City Christian by a score of 80-66, albeit [player_tooltip player_id='1503881' first='Benson' last='Kieffer'] went out with an injury. [player_tooltip player_id='1384718' first='Marvin' last='Richard III'] was named the MVP of the LNI and the rest of the Thorpe cast is no joke. Coming up, Pine Ridge plays Groton at the Corn Palace, that will be a good test. Keep eyes on the Thorpes, they are seriously talented!</p>
